What is the Gloria in the Catholic Mass?

“Gloria in excelsis Deo” (Latin for “Glory to God in the highest”) is a Christian hymn known also as the Greater Doxology (as distinguished from the “Minor Doxology” or Gloria Patri) and the Angelic Hymn/Hymn of the Angels. The name is often abbreviated to Gloria in Excelsis or simply Gloria.

What age is Gloria country singer?

Gloria Smyth (born May 1951), better known as Gloria is an Irish singer from Navan, County Meath. She rose to fame in Ireland during the 1970s with “One Day at a Time” which spent longer in the Irish charts than any other single to date (90 weeks). She later toured under her married name of Gloria Sherry.

Did Laura write Gloria?

Laura Ann Branigan (July 3, 1952 – August 26, 2004) was an American singer, songwriter, and actress. Her signature song, the platinum-certified 1982 single “Gloria”, stayed on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100 for 36 weeks, then a record for a female artist, peaking at No. 2….
